Output f502d5c08bd65c6ad128d666fae798db4d9cc2cfb0cc6775207b491609b9b7b1:3

value
11402026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 224e3d9ed3c5ee665daec242de59f66feb2ad33a OP_EQUAL
address
34pQdKq6bic8AFo32EUjGKXqxcn1Ear5cD
transaction
f502d5c08bd65c6ad128d666fae798db4d9cc2cfb0cc6775207b491609b9b7b1
confirmations
257540
spent
true